This side-by-side compares ZIP 04674 (Seal Cove, ME) and ZIP 04612 (Bernard, ME) using the same Census ACS 5-Year table fields for both — no averages swapped in, no national proxies. ZIP 04674 has a population of 484 at 22 people per square mile, while ZIP 04612 has 589 at 41 per square mile. That difference in population size and density alone reshapes how every other metric should be interpreted — a higher-income ZIP with 1,200 residents behaves very differently from one with 45,000.

On income and education, ZIP 04674 reports a median household income of $76,667 against $89,839 in ZIP 04612, with per-capita income of $33,375 vs $60,679. The share of adults holding a bachelor's degree or higher is 30.1% in 04674 and 60.2% in 04612. Poverty rate reads 3.7% vs 7.6%, and unemployment 2.3% vs 5.3% — these four fields alone drive most of the difference in the scorecard grades you will see for each ZIP.

Housing separates these two ZIPs further: median home value sits at $373,500 in 04674 versus $407,300 in 04612, with median rent of $1,292 and $1,105 per month respectively. Homeownership rate is 76.7% vs 80.0%.
